Analysis Of Energy Knowledge In Senior High School Physics Textbooks And College Entrance Examination Questions ——Take The 2017 PEP Senior High School Physics Textbook And The National High School Entrance Examination Questions In

The new curriculum reform puts forward the requirement of developing students' physical core literacy.One of the four dimensions of physical core literacy is physical concept,and energy-related knowledge is an important part of physical concept.The physical movement is accompanied by the change of energy.The knowledge of energy runs through the whole senior high school physics curriculum,and the concept of energy plays an important role in senior high school physics teaching.Physics textbook is an important resource for teachers to prepare lessons,and it is also the first-hand information for students to learn.Therefore,the energy knowledge part of physics textbook is selected for research,hoping that the teaching function of physics textbook can be better brought into play.The college entrance examination affects the teaching to a certain extent,and the new situation of energy knowledge in the college entrance examination questions is explored,which provides some references for physics teaching in Senior Three.The paper determined that the objects to be studied were the physics textbooks for senior high schools published by People's Education Edition in 2017 and the national unified examination questions for college entrance examination in 2017-2021.From them,the contents related to energy knowledge were selected for statistical analysis based on the dimensions of energy connotation,and the knowledge frameworks of mechanics,electromagnetism,thermodynamics,optics and atomic physics modules were built respectively.It was found that each module was interrelated and the level of knowledge was spiraling,so the study of energy-related knowledge was helpful to promote students' knowledge.In recent five years,the examination frequency of energy-related knowledge in the national college entrance examination questions is high,and the scores of multiple-choice questions and selected questions are large.Multiple-choice questions mainly examine energy-related knowledge in mechanics,electromagnetism,optics and atomic physics,while selected questions mainly examine energy-related knowledge in thermodynamics.The frequency of examining kinetic energy theorem in calculation questions is relatively high.Although the score is relatively low,kinetic energy theorem equation is generally the bridge of the whole question in calculation questions.The experimental examination verifies kinetic energy theorem combined with paper tape kinematics formula,and the electric power of small bulb in circuit.Most of the calculation problems are multi-process analysis based on the conventional model,to find the critical position and analyze the energy conversion of each part.This paper puts forward some suggestions on the teaching of energy-related knowledge: teachers should take the initiative to establish an energy knowledge framework and guide students to transfer their knowledge;Infiltrate the history of physics into teaching,stimulate students' interest in learning physics,and strengthen the integration of disciplines;Teachers collect information about China's "energy" development and local characteristics to promote students' national self-confidence;Teachers summarize the problem-solving methods of exercises involving energy knowledge,and statistically analyze the types and scores of energy-related knowledge in college entrance examination questions,so that students can better understand the problem-solving ideas of energy-related knowledge.
